Own, as in to own means poseer (yo poseo, tú posees...) although in Peru it is often replaced by the verb to have (yo tengo, tú tienes...) which is a common peruvian misuse of the verb.
Own as in a house of my own, or as in my own house, can always be translated as propio (m) / propia (f). (Gender related declinations are always a problem for those who have English as native language.)
I would like a place of my own, Yo quiero una casa propia.
you have your own car, Tú tienes tu propio carro.
would you like a drink of your own? ¿Quieres un trago propio?
Although in the last case it doesn't sound quite right, it would be best to say:
would like your own drink? ¿Quieres tu propio trago?
